ElectroCraft, Inc. provides application-engineered specialty fractional-horsepower motor and motion control products. Under the hood, Electrocraft motion systems power critical components of some of the world's most innovative products in medical equipment, robotics, industrial automation, agriculture, and lab equipment. Some of our innovative products include DC motors, gear motors, linear actuators, and motor drives.
